ffosilva Posted March 1, 2010 Share Posted March 1, 2010 I'm not certain but I think it's not on DSDT.DSL. Fn is just an modifier, it changes the value of keystroke. I think BIOS understand and do something on some keystrokes like Wireless (enabler and disabler), NumLock, CapsLock, ScrollLock but in this case I think this action is defined on an level lower than DSDT.
